ALARM SOUNDED OVER AMENDMENTS PROPOSED TO FOREST CONSERVATION ACT 1980

NEW DELHI, Jul. 24, 2023 (TBINN)

As Lok Sabha prepares for a crucial vote on the Forest (Conservation) Amendment Bill 2023 during ongoing Monsoon Session, environmentalists, activists and other stake-holders across the Himalayas are sounding an alarm over the potential ramifications of the Bill in its current form.

Key amendments proposed to The Forest (Conservation) Act (F.C.A.), 1980 include adding a preamble, renaming the Act to ‘Van (Sanrakshan Evam Samvardhan) Adhiniyam’, limiting its applicability to lands recorded as forest in government records and exempting certain categories of land from its purview.

Conservationists argue that limiting the applicability of F.C.A. to land recorded as forest in government records would effectively invalidate the Supreme Court’s 1996’s judgment in the T.N. Godavarman Case, which said the Act was applicable to land covered under the “dictionary meaning of forests” or “deemed forests” (forests not officially recorded as forests).
